STEEL BUMPER RE-CONSTRUCTION

Bumper re-construction is accomplished by inserting metal patches in areas which have deteriorated beyond workable condition. Metal preparation for plating requires suitably thick metal on which to grind and polish. Thin weak metal which has rusted through must be replaced for a bumper to turn out acceptable. Areas of weak metal are cut out and replacement patches shaped to match the opening are fashioned out of bumper metal. The replacement patch is needed in place with the weld seam being touched up during polishing to minimize pin-holes.
